SIRTE, Libya, Oct 27 (Reuters) - The Sudanese government declared on Saturday a unilateral ceasefire in Darfur with immediate effect, Khartoum's top negotiator at peace talks in Libya said.
"We announce a ceasefire from this moment, and we will respect it unilaterally," presidential advisor Nafie Ali Nafie told the gathering.
NEW YORK (Reuters) - Time Warner Cable and News Corp's Fox Networks agreed to a brief extension of their current carriage contract on Thursday to avoid a blackout that would have prevented 13 million U.S. homes from seeing TV shows like "The Simpsons" and college and NFL football games.
